I do karate twice a week. For a 90 minute martial arts session MFP gives me an additional 1269 calories and for my 120 minute session it gives me an additional 1669 - these all seem very high.... any ideas???

    Yes a heart rate monitor is the best way to measure how much effort you are putting in. I personally found when I did martial arts that I wasn't working as hard as the system assumed because you aren't constantly kicking and punching for the entire class (in fact in my class we did a lot of standing around watching the instructors). For me it's the same with Spin - I am not "vigorously cycling" for the ENTIRE 45 min class.
